What Are Ad Extensions and Why Are They Important?

Ad extensions are additional pieces of information that you can add to your ads on Google Ads and Microsoft Ads platforms. They make your ads more engaging, informative, and effective by providing extra details, such as your business address, phone number, and customer ratings, among others. Ad extensions can help improve your click-through rate (CTR), boost ad visibility, and ultimately, enhance your return on investment (ROI).

The main benefits of ad extensions include:

  • Providing additional relevant information to users
  • Enhancing the visual appeal and prominence of your ads
  • Improving ad engagement and CTR
  • Potentially improving ad rank and lowering cost-per-click (CPC)

Types of Ad Extensions Available in Google Ads and Microsoft Ads

Both Google Ads and Microsoft Ads offer a variety of ad extensions, each designed to serve different purposes. Here, we will cover the most common ad extensions available in both platforms:

A. Sitelink Extensions:

Sitelink extensions allow you to add additional links to your ad that lead to specific pages on your website, such as product pages, promotions, or contact information. This can help users navigate directly to relevant content, increasing the chances of a conversion.

B. Call Extensions:

By adding your phone number or a call button to your ad, call extensions make it easy for users to contact your business directly. This is especially valuable for mobile users, who can simply tap the call button to initiate a call.

C. Location Extensions:

Displaying your business’s address and a link to directions can help drive more foot traffic to your physical location. Location extensions can also show the distance between the user and your business, providing additional motivation for potential customers to visit.

D. Callout Extensions:

These allow you to showcase unique selling points, promotions, or important information about your business in short, attention-grabbing snippets. Callout extensions can help you differentiate your business from competitors and give users more reasons to choose your products or services.

E. Structured Snippet Extensions:

Structured snippets offer a way to highlight specific aspects of your products or services by presenting them in a list format. For example, you can showcase a list of product categories, service offerings, or brands you carry.

F. Price Extensions:

Display your product or service prices directly in your ad, making it easier for users to compare options and make a decision. This can help attract users with a higher intent to purchase, leading to increased conversions.

G. Review Extensions:

Showcasing positive customer reviews and testimonials can build trust and credibility for your business. Review extensions allow you to display third-party reviews from reputable sources, helping to persuade potential customers to choose your brand.

Best Practices for Implementing Ad Extensions

To maximize the benefits of ad extensions, follow these best practices:

Use multiple ad extensions:

Implementing various ad extensions can help you provide a more comprehensive and engaging ad experience. However, ensure that each extension adds value and is relevant to your target audience.

Prioritize mobile users:

With the increasing number of users accessing the internet via mobile devices, ensure your ad extensions are optimized for mobile viewing. For instance, use call extensions for easy communication and location extensions for driving foot traffic to your store.

Test different ad extension combinations:

Experiment with different combinations of ad extensions to determine which works best for your specific campaigns. Monitor their performance and make adjustments as needed to optimize results.

Keep information up-to-date:

Ensure that all information in your ad extensions is accurate and current. Regularly review and update details such as pricing, promotions, and contact information to provide users with the most reliable information.

Use extensions in conjunction with other ad strategies:

Ad extensions can be even more effective when combined with other ad optimization techniques, such as bidding strategies and targeting settings. For example, use ad extensions alongside geotargeting to reach potential customers within a specific location.

Analyzing Ad Extension Performance

To measure the effectiveness of your ad extensions and make data-driven decisions, both Google Ads and Microsoft Ads provide detailed performance reports. Monitor metrics such as:

Click-through rate (CTR):

Compare the CTR of ads with and without extensions to evaluate the impact of ad extensions on user engagement.

Conversion rate:

Analyze whether the use of ad extensions is leading to an increase in conversions, such as sales or sign-ups.

Cost-per-conversion (CPA):

Assess if the addition of ad extensions results in a lower cost-per-conversion, indicating increased efficiency of your advertising budget.

Ad rank and CPC:

Observe if ad extensions have a positive effect on your ad rank, which can lead to better ad placements and potentially lower CPC.

Extension-specific metrics:

Some ad extensions, such as call and location extensions, have their own performance metrics. Analyze these to understand how users are interacting with specific extensions.
